The only advice I can give so far is that you should consider all kinds of test cases that you can think of, determine the expected result, and see if your code provides these results.

The key is to think of all corner cases, such as unmatched brackets, opening brackets without a leading number, nested brackets, etc.. I'm not even sure how the first two should be dealt with - do you know?
